Knit Happens
Photo by Matt RoseBy day, she’ll whip you into shape. At night, she competes in the Knitting Olympics.
by Melanie McGee Bianchi
April Dennis is no drill sergeant. “I am not a yeller,” says the 45-year-old personal trainer and co-owner of The Fire Personal Training Studio in East Asheville. But she can be intense when it comes to her own workouts or helping her clients shed pounds with exercises like boxing, jump rope and kettlebell swings. People appreciate her enthusiasm in the gym. “Afterwards, they’ll say, ‘Oh, I had so much fun… but I’m so sore I can hardly move,’” she says.
Still, the clink of steel dumbbells and sweaty intensity of the gym couldn’t be further from her peaceful, meditative pastime: knitting. Taught by her grandmother, she re-learned knitting in college while recovering from a broken leg. And yet while she gushes sweetly about gorgeous lace-weight yarn, she can’t quite hide the competitive urge that crosses over from her career into her hobby.
A member of the online group Ravelry, Dennis competed in this year’s Knitting Olympics. Participants were expected to start and finish a project between the Winter Games’ opening and closing ceremonies. (She ran out of material at the eleventh hour, and, in order to finish her shawl in time, she sprinted to a local shop, bought the appropriate shade of hand-dyed blue fiber and spun it into yarn on her own drop spindle.) Further evidence of a jock streak: Dennis likes to make her own material and was a recent contender in the annual online spin-off Le Tour de Fleece.
Dennis is a solo knitter. She is not a fan of the “stitch-n-bitch” (a social knitting club), nor does she consider herself a hipster craft revivalist. Instead, she has seamlessly interwoven a pair of remarkably disparate callings. Her daily workouts are essential to keep in top condition, while her nighttime knitting can be yoga-like—calming, and just as critical to her overall wellbeing. “I get antsy if I don’t get to sit and be still with my knitting,” she says.
